Output a3426640762fffd7e674062a7f289488288b59f2b409b409e1576aca3a093eca:17
- value
- 8520897
- script pubkey
- OP_0 OP_PUSHBYTES_20 8e7ce176b6f380cafd161c7d2b32db14cb4a5abe
- address
- bc1q3e7wza4k7wqv4lgkr37jkvkmzn955k47ayn485
- transaction
- a3426640762fffd7e674062a7f289488288b59f2b409b409e1576aca3a093eca